[Detailed Description of the Invention] (Industrial Application Field) The present invention relates to a partition plate device for multi-stage display shelves in product display cases used in food stores and the like.

(Prior Art) Generally, in food sales corners of department stores, etc., in horizontally long display cases with multi-tiered shelves installed by the department store, vendors who wish to display the display cases are asked to arrange the display cases at the required intervals using vertical partitions. It is divided and allotted display space. In this case, conventional methods of partitioning the display space include placing a partition plate with an L-shaped cross section on the shelf board, or screwing a similar partition plate to the shelf board. Not only are the boards prone to falling over,
Because the partitions tend to shift easily, it is difficult to maintain proper partitions, and the latter also has the disadvantage that it takes time and effort to change the position of the partition plates when it is desired to change the display space.

(Means for Solving the Problems) As a means for solving the above problems, the multi-shelf partition plate device of the present invention includes a plurality of partition plates respectively placed on the plurality of shelf boards, and It consists of a vertical plate that is placed vertically on the front side of each shelf board, and the front end of each of the above partition plates is respectively locked, and each of the above partition plates has a locking piece protruding from its front end, and , the locking piece is provided with a locking portion, and the vertical plate has a flat U-shaped groove opening toward the rear where the locking piece is removably inserted in the cross section, and The structure is such that a locked portion is provided within the U-shaped groove to be releasably locked to the locking portion. (Example) In Fig. 1, a food display case 1 is a horizontally elongated one having display shelves 2 of multiple stages (three stages in the figure), and partition plates 3 are placed on top of the shelves 2 to mutually separate them. The front ends of the partition plates 3 are placed in vertically corresponding positions, and the locking pieces 5 are attached to the elongated vertical plates 4 of the present invention, which are vertically abutted against the front ends of the shelf boards 2. . . , and thereby divide the display space in the display case by using each partition plate 3 as a series of vertical partition surfaces.

The partition plate 3 has a substantially angular shape with a seat plate 6 extending at right angles on its lower side, and has a key-shaped plate-like locking piece 5 at one end thereof at its front end, as shown in the second and third figures. The locking piece 5 is pivotally connected on the surface of the partition plate 3 by a pin 7, and a locking protrusion 8 is provided as a locking portion protruding from the side surface of the tip end of the locking piece 5 (see FIG. 3).

The vertical plate 4 is made of an elastic material such as synthetic resin or metal, and is an elongated plate-shaped body having a flat U-shaped cross section as shown in the third figure. It has a groove width that can hold the tip end with the locking protrusion 8 of the groove 9, and on one side of the inner surface of the groove mouth of the groove 9,
As a locked part, a locked protrusion 1 extending over the entire length of the groove mouth
0 is provided protrudingly to narrow the groove opening. The narrow groove opening is formed to have a groove width that allows the locking piece 5 to be clamped therein. Further, in the groove 9, on one side of the opposing inner surface, several holding protrusions 11 are provided at the tip of the locking piece 5 at positions corresponding to the partition plates 3. They are protruded along the longitudinal direction of the vertical plate at intervals slightly wider than the width. 12 is a stopper at the uppermost end within the groove 9.

The vertical board 4 having the above structure is positioned in front of each shelf board 2 with its groove facing toward the display case 1, and in this state, the seat board 6 is placed on top of each shelf board 2. The holding protrusion 1 in the groove 9 from the narrowing groove opening of the vertical plate 4 selects the selected portion of each locking piece 5 of the placed partition plate 3.
Press fit between 1 and 11. In this way, the locking protrusion 8 of each locking piece 5 locks on the locking protrusion 10 of the vertical plate 4 and is connected to prevent it from coming off, and each locking piece 5 is connected to the locking protrusion 10 of the vertical plate 4. It is clamped in the groove 9, thereby forming a continuous structure between the vertical plate 4 and the plurality of partition plates 3, which holds each partition plate 3 in a state that prevents it from falling down and from shifting from side to side. The vertical plate 4 is held vertically on the front side of the display case.

If the vertical distance between the shelf boards 2... differs depending on the displayed product or the type of display case, the tip of the locking piece 5 of each partition board 3...
The holding protrusions 11, 11 corresponding to the holding protrusions 11, 11 may be selected and press-fitted into the groove 9. Moreover, when the inclinations of the shelf boards 2 are different, the locking piece 5 swings appropriately around the pin 7, thereby forming a continuous structure in the same manner as described above.

(Effect of the invention) According to the multi-tiered display shelf partition plate device of the present invention, a continuous connection structure is formed between a vertical plate and a plurality of partition plates placed on a plurality of shelf plates via locking pieces. By doing so, it is possible to hold each partition plate in a state that prevents it from falling over and from shifting from side to side.Thereby, it is possible to maintain accurate partitioning of the display space.Also, if you want to change the position of the partition, you can use the above-mentioned continuous connection. It also has the advantage that changes can be made extremely easily by simply moving the structure from side to side, which is extremely effective in practice.
